Choosing the Right Material: Butcher Blocks vs Built-in Countertops
When considering a built-in chopping station or butcher block counter for your gourmet kitchen renovation, one of the most important decisions is material choice. Traditional butcher blocks offer a warm, rustic aesthetic and are known for their durability and versatility. However, in terms of a professional-grade kitchen remodel, modern built-in countertops made from solid surface materials like quartz or granite provide an equally robust and sanitary option.
For the cooking enthusiast looking to create an efficient kitchen layout for chefs, built-in countertops often win out due to their seamless integration with other high-end kitchen appliances. This continuous surface not only looks clean and modern but also allows for easier food preparation and cleanup, catering perfectly to the needs of a functional kitchen for cooking.
